Summary

On this week's show, Empire's Chris Hewitt parachutes in to join Boyd in giving Better Call Saul some long overdue love. Plus we look at parenting with Rafe Spall and Esther Smith in Apple's Trying, sample a technological afterlife in Amazon’s Upload, see Danny Mays brought back to life in Sky’s Code 404, investigate a kidnapping with Cobie Smulders in Stumptown, and find out what's going on behind the curtains in series 2 of Channel 5's Blood. All that and James bangs on about season 4 of The Last Kingdom. Because of course he does.
